• Rules. Utah follows the federal requirements for importing and exporting chemicals. Utah has no additional requirements. See the national section IMPORTS AND EXPORTS OF CHEMICALS.
Utah has adopted the federal hazardous materials regulations and the federal motor carrier safety regulations, with the exception of some safety regulation exemptions. See the state section HAZARDOUS MATERIALS TRANSPORTERS and the national section IMPORTS AND EXPORTS OF CHEMICALS for more information. In addition, a security plan may be required by hazardous materials transporters. The plan must include an assessment of possible transportation security risks for hazmat shipments.
